Copper metallic P-bass pic's anyone?

Sign in to disble this ad
I'm thinking about buying a new MIM copper metallic P-bass. I need to see some pics other than the ones with blank white backgrounds that all the online stores have. Can anyone post some pics of it in a natural or gigging setting. Also for anyone who has one, are you satisfied (tone and playability) when using it on a gig?

We had a few of these at Daddy's. The finish has a slight sparkle to it, that would look awesome under lights. I would say the best color for a pick guard would be a "partchment" color (an off-white look).

Other than that, it plays and sounds like any other Mexican Pbass I've played.
